What to expect from hiring a damp surveyor in Somerset
A house damp survey is a detailed inspection to find the source of damp and advise on treatment.
Common jobs requested include:
- Investigating rising damp, penetrating damp, or condensation issues
- Inspecting after a homebuyer survey has flagged damp
- Assessing suspected damp and mould in older properties or basements
Average damp survey costs in Somerset:
- 2-bedroom flat: £200
- 3-bedroom terraced house: £400
- 4-bedroom detached house: £600
Costs are usually based on property size, not the type of damp.
Additional costs to consider:
- Specialist lab testing (if needed)
- Travel costs for rural areas
- Follow-up inspections after treatment
What’s included in a typical damp survey
- Initial consultation on your property’s history and symptoms
- External inspection (walls, gutters, drains, pipes)
- Internal inspection (walls, ceilings, floors) for water stains, mould, flaking paint
- Moisture readings
- Photographs and written notes
- A full survey report with treatment recommendations and cost estimates
Qualifications to check for
- Certified Surveyor in Remedial Treatments (CSRT)
- Certified Surveyor in Structural Waterproofing (CSSW)
- Property Care Association (PCA) membership
- Public Liability Insurance
How long does a damp survey take?
A standard damp survey in Somerset takes around 3 - 4 hours. Reports are usually sent within 1 - 2 days.
Damp surveys in Somerset: Homeowners vs renters
For homeowners:
You’re responsible for diagnosing and fixing damp in your property. If you're buying a property, a damp survey can help you renegotiate the price or plan repairs before moving in. If you already own a property, acting quickly can prevent more expensive fixes later.
For renters:
Landlords are generally responsible for damp caused by structural issues or necessary repairs. Report damp to your landlord or letting agent in writing. A damp and mould surveyor near you can provide evidence if repairs are disputed.
Emergency damp survey in Somerset
Some damp problems can’t wait, like sudden water ingress after heavy rain or leaks causing visible mould growth. In these cases, you may need an emergency damp specialist to assess and advise quickly.
